Engine & Performance:
It is powered with a single electric motor, mounted on the front wheels and rated at approximately 167 PS of power and 215 Nm of torque to provide a nice and responsive driving experience. With its zero to one hundred kilometer (km/h) delivery of instant torque, the SUV accelerates zero to one hundred kilometers (km/h) in about 8.6 seconds; this is fast enough to engage in the daily commute in urban centers and with confidence to take the highway without worrying about not reaching his/her destination.
Charging Performance & Technology:
The Tata Curvv EV SeriesX has convenient and modern charging options; supporting DC fast charging, which can charge the battery up to 80 percent in about 40 minutes using a 70 kW charger, and a standard home AC wall box takes about 7-8 hours to fully charge the battery. It is also equipped on the technological front with more useful and innovative features such as Vehicle-to-Load (V2L) and Vehicle-to-Vehicle (V2V) charging.

Tata Curvv EV SeriesX Price & Range:
The Tata Curvv EV SeriesX begins at a competitive price of ₹16.99 lakh (ex-showroom) and comes in three well-equipped variants, Accomplished X 55, Empowered X 55 and stylish Empowered X 55 Dark Edition. All models have a standardized 55 kWh battery pack, which is said to give them an impressive claimed range up to 502 km (ARAI), under real-world driving conditions.
On the ownership front, Tata offers a secure warranty package, with a lifetime battery warranty (up to 15 years) being the highlight, peace of mind throughout the years, and confidence in its EV technology.
Variants, Features & Price Explained
1. Accomplished X 55
The entry level variant of the SeriesX lineup, which has a very high cost, is the Tata Curvv EV SeriesX Accomplished X 55, priced at ₹16.99 lakh (ex-showroom). It is a powerful value package that has premium essentials such as LED headlights, panoramic sunroof, dual digital screens (infotainment + instrument cluster), and wireless Android Auto and Apple CarPlay. It will be best suited to those buyers who want the capability of long-range EV and the latest features without necessarily having to stretch their budget.
2. Empowered X 55
The Tata Curvv EV SeriesX Empowered X 55 is the highest priced regular model, costing 19.19 lakh (ex-showroom). It is based on the Accomplished trim but includes additional luxurious and technology-oriented features like a larger Harman touchscreen, JBL 9-speaker sound system, powered driver seat, gesture-controlled tailgate and Level-2 ADAS with various safety features. This is the ideal version designed to suit those customers who prefer a fully loaded version of an EV powered by technology.
3. Powered X 55 Dark Edition.
The Tata Curvv EV SeriesX Empowered X 55 Dark Edition costs 19.49 lakh (ex- showroom) and has the same features as the Empowered X 55 but comes with an exclusive all-black styling package. It incorporates an appearance of the blacked out exterior components, a dark themed interior, and a more sporty outlook, making it a perfect choice to consumers who give an excellent outlook to their purchase along with premium features.
